About the Opportunity

We’re partnering with one of the UK’s leading and fastest-growing chicken QSR brands to find an exceptional Operations Manager who knows how to lead people, build great teams and deliver consistently strong commercial results.

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ced Area Manager, Area Coach, District Manager or Regional Manager from QSR, hospitality or casual dining who thrives in a fast-paced, high-growth environment.


You’ll take ownership of a portfolio of restaurants, leading and developing your General Managers while creating a culture where people enjoy coming to work, customers receive an outstanding experience and commercial performance continues to grow.

This is a hands-on leadership role. You’ll be visible in your restaurants, close to your teams and confident using the numbers to identify opportunities and drive sales, profitability and operational excellence.


What You’ll Be Doing

  • Lead the day-to-day performance of multiple restaurant locations, with full accountability for operational and commercial results.
  • Coach, challenge and develop General Managers to build consistently high-performing restaurants.
  • Deliver against key KPIs, with a particular focus on sales growth, profitability, labour, food costs and operational standards.
  • Recruit, develop and retain great people while building a strong internal talent and succession pipeline.
  • Create an engaging, high-energy culture where teams feel motivated, recognised and accountable.
  • Keep the customer at the heart of every decision, continually improving service, experience, reviews and guest feedback.
  • Ensure consistently excellent standards across food quality, service, cleanliness and restaurant presentation.
  • Analyse restaurant and area performance, identify opportunities and turn insights into clear action plans.
  • Manage budgets and cost controls while identifying opportunities to improve restaurant profitability.
  • Ensure restaurants operate safely and in line with all regulatory, food safety and company requirements.
  • Work closely with central support teams to remove barriers and give restaurant teams what they need to succeed.
  • Implement operational policies and standards consistently across your area.
  • Lead continuous improvement initiatives that make restaurants more efficient, commercially successful and enjoyable places to work and visit.


What We’re Looking For

You’ll already have a strong track record leading multiple sites within QSR, casual dining or a similarly fast-paced hospitality business.

You’ll also bring:

  • Proven multi-site operational leadership experience.
  • A strong commercial mindset and confidence managing a multi-site P&L.
  • A track record of delivering sales, profit and operational KPIs.
  • Excellent leadership skills with the ability to coach, motivate and inspire General Managers and their teams.
  • Significant experience in recruitment, people development, performance management and succession planning.
  • The ability to interpret financial and operational data and turn it into practical actions.
  • Strong organisational and problem-solving skills.
  • High standards and a genuine passion for delivering an outstanding customer experience.
  • Good knowledge of food safety, health & safety and regulatory compliance.
  • A leadership style that combines high standards, clear accountability and plenty of energy.


Most importantly, you’ll be someone who leads from the front. You’ll know that great restaurant performance starts with great people, and you’ll be equally comfortable developing a future leader, challenging an underperforming restaurant or getting into the detail of the numbers.
